Output eca506bbcfe3ead90b53a462540d87b6cc2b6bce866d043f66281f63ee38404e:1

value
1596575690
script pubkey
OP_0 OP_PUSHBYTES_20 2622ff16e13ad0f3f685495e0ade15f776a37cee
address
ltc1qyc3079hp8tg08a59f90q4hs47am2xl8wt70pug
transaction
eca506bbcfe3ead90b53a462540d87b6cc2b6bce866d043f66281f63ee38404e
spent
true